Based in the Marlborough Region, Pa Road is made by the te Pa winery which has a history stemming back almost 800 years. Set up by the MacDonald family whose Maori lineage goes back to 1350, the te Pa estate spreads over 400Ha of vineyards in Marlborough’s Wairau and Awatere regions.
The Riverside Block of Pinot Gris is located on the silt/stone soils by the lower Wairau River. This young block is in its second year of production and produces ripe and generous stone fruit flavours. The fruit was gently pressed in temperature-controlled stainless steel tanks and fermented with yeast strains isolated from Alsace. The wine was left on fine lees for 3 months prior to being finished and bottled. It is then blended with 5% of its Alsace counter-part, Gewurztraminer, which adds an extra layer of floral and tropical aromas.
This wine possesses a lovely floral bouquet with honeysuckle, fennel, and lingering spice. The palate is rich and juicy and explodes with flavours of pear and guava leading into a long dry spicy finish.
